Abstract
A resonance frequency of a near field communication (NFC) antenna module may be set to be equal to a first frequency by a resonance unit included in the NFC antenna module. The NFC module may include a matching circuit connected to the NFC antenna module. The matching circuit may include terminals exposed to the outside such that the antenna module is detachable from the matching circuit.

8. A near field communication (NFC) module comprising:
-
an antenna module including a first terminal, a second terminal, an antenna connected to the first and second terminals, and a resonance unit; a matching circuit including a plurality of passive devices; and an NFC controller connected to the matching circuit, wherein the antenna module is configured to resonate at a first frequency, to be directly connectable to the matching circuit, and to be detachable from the matching circuit, the NFC controller is configured to output or receive a signal of a second frequency, and the resonance unit is integrated as part of the antenna module and comprises a first passive device configured to have a value such that the first frequency is set regardless of the plurality of passive devices within the matching circuit. - View Dependent Claims (9, 10, 11, 12, 13, 14, 15, 16)
